Investment on Home:
An increasing amount of money is being spent on home improvements, it has been revealed. Families who spent more money on home improvements realise the greatest rates of price appreciation. Figures released by Sainsbury's Home Insurance reveal that at present a total of £1,162 is set to be splashed out on alterations

and improvements over the course of this year. The figure marks a rise of 2.97 per cent from the £1,128 that was spent in 2007.
